  • Consuming external web services in SAP Data Services functionality requires configuring the software's built-in web services datastore type. The web services datastore provides support for locating and importing metadata for a web services server as well as invoking web service operations.
    The web services datastore works by sending a request and waiting until it receives a reply from a web services server.
    For example, you might create a web services server as a front-end to a legacy application. You could call the web services server daily from a data flow to access inventory and update an inventory data mart.
    The interaction between the web services datastore and an external web service has these parts:
    1. Creating a web services datastore that identifies the WSDL, which describes the web services server.
    2. Importing metadata to extract the information form the WSDL needed to access the web service server.
    3.Creating a data flow that uses the imported function call to call the web services server.

  • What is cloud computing? Cloud computing makes it possible for users to access data, applications, and services over the Internet. The cloud eliminates the need for costly hardware, such as hard drives and servers – and gives users the ability to work from anywhere. Over 90% of businesses are already using cloud technology in a public, private, or hybrid cloud environment.
    The major benefits of cloud include:
    a. Elasticity: Scale up or down quickly to meet computing demand
    b. Affordability: Only pay for what you use, and minimize hardware and IT costs
    c. Availability: Get 24/7 cloud system access from anywhere, on any device
    d. Simplicity: Free IT from managing servers and updating software
    Cloud software offers a number of distinct advantages that help sharpen your competitive edge.
    The top 3 reasons to move to the cloud:
    1. Use it to deploy faster, with lower upfront costs
    2. Accelerate innovation cycles with hassle-free, more frequent updates
    3. Leverage anytime scalability and dynamic capacity to boost flexibility and compete with big businesses
